Crawling VS Scraping 4

Difference Between Web Scraping And Web Crawling


Crawling VS Scraping



Travel & Hospitality Data Build better relations with the latest lodge and ticketing data. Finance & Stock Market Data Take the most effective investment choices with up-to-date monetary information. Research & Journalism Data Power your subsequent information story, article or analysis project.
If you want to learn more on recommendations on the way to use proxies for enterprise, you’ll find it in our weblog submit. Data-pushed, and consequently, insight-pushed companies outperform their friends. By tracking consumer interplay and gaining an in-depth understanding of their behaviors, companies can enhance their buyer experience. They need to operate in a trend such that they don’t offend the servers, and need to be dexterous sufficient to extract all the data required. This is why sure webpages have crawling restrictions to control their crawling course of.
When you select to get data with the assistance of a website’s API, you’re very restricted within the customization. You can’t control elements of customization similar to format, structure, fields, frequency or another particular traits. It’s simply unimaginable to get a excessive degree of information customization with API. Also, when there are specific adjustments in the web site, these modifications within the knowledge structure would reflect in the API solely months later. Thereby, Price Aggregation Proxies extracted through an API tool is probably not dependable.
The worth index change impacts all of the industries related to actual property. This, likewise, impacts lifetime value and can enhance mannequin loyalty. Web scraping – deduplication isn’t all the time needed as it may be carried out manually, therefore in smaller scales.
However, you might wonder what it’s received to do with net scraping. So whereas web scraping, you have to guarantee that you’re not in violation of this act. Under this act, an unauthorized use of data from a web web page can be liable to legal motion.

Data Scraping Vs Data Crawling: What’S The Difference?


The net crawling carried out by these web spiders and bots have to be accomplished carefully with attention and proper care. The depth of the penetration should not violate the restrictions of websites or privacy guidelines when they’re crawling totally different websites. Any infringement of such can lead to lawsuits from no matter massive information domain that could have been offended, and that is one thing that no person needs entangled in. Modern crawling bots are developed to better perceive what the limits of operations are and abide inside the constraints to avoid authorized entanglements. Due to those technological advancements, the risk of offending are minimal.
Hope this weblog will assist you to keep away from the legal problems and allow you to make great scraping decisions. Websites maintain some information available for public use and permit anybody and everybody to entry it. However, there’s some data on the web site which is not for public entry. Scraping public information may not be strictly unlawful however you could have uncovered yourself to a scenario by which an organization can initiate action in opposition to you if it needs. When it involves scraping, people are inclined to cross the lines quite often.
Web crawling can be seen as analogous to the creation of such a map where “bots”, “spiders”, or “crawlers” scan, index and document all the websites, pages and sub-pages. This information is then stored and referred to as upon whenever a person does a search. Increases in income are definitely impressive, however lengthy-term development can also be a important think about figuring out the success of a business. A recent report by Forrester Research confirms that businesses that leverage knowledge strategies develop more than 30 percent annually, and are on monitor to earn $1.8 trillion by 2021. Almost everyone knows in regards to the importance of massive knowledge, particularly the creation, collection and evaluation of knowledge on the web.
One of most likely probably the most difficult points inside the net crawling area is to deal with the coordination of successive crawls. Our spiders need to be properly mannered with the servers that they hit so that they don’t piss them off and this creates an attention-grabbing state of affairs to handle. Our clever spiders should get more clever (and never loopy!). To crawl knowledge on its net pages whereas complying with its politeness insurance policies.
What’s not so obvious is that each group in existence today can leverage the facility of data. My work at Oxylabs has given me a unique vantage point the place I actually have seen many forms of businesses benefit throughout almost each business. Oxylabs.io will process your information so as to administer your inquiry and inform you about our services. There is no easy reply to the query “is internet scraping authorized?
If you put in any of these drivers, let’s say Chrome, it’s going to open an instance of the browser and tons of your web page, you then’ll have the ability to scrape or interact along with your page. This line will get the first span factor on the Beautiful Soup object then scrape all anchor elements beneath that span. So principally, you could be very limited in what and how much you’ll be able to extract.

Web crawling usually have its duplicate online content material that’s the reason a few of the duplicated data will filter out such knowledge only if needed as nicely. Web scraping does not intend to have de-duplication except it is needed, as a result of it can be done manually by hand on a smaller scale of data. Web crawling crawls out to the information information from its selected goal.
Equity research was once restricted to studying financial statements of an organization and accordingly investing in stocks. Now, each information merchandise, knowledge point, and measures of sentiment are essential in identifying the right stock and its current development. It may help you fetch all the information aggregation related to the market and allow you to look at the massive picture. You can, in fact, extract financial statements and all the conventional data from the web sites in a a lot easier and faster method via internet scraping. Likewise, when it comes to an e-commerce business, one would need numerous pictures and product descriptions that you just can’t merely create in a single day or copy and paste easily.
The price index change impacts all the industries associated to real property. Thus, corporations should extract the most recent knowledge from the online to later analyze it and make decisions accordingly. All traveling businesses at all times declare to have the bottom costs and finest provides, so that they must be properly conscious of all of the possible adjustments that occur in the industry. The home price index is up to date within the nation’s national statistics frequently.
Housing & Real Estate Data Create efficient marketing strategies with insighful housing data. Jobs & Human Capital Data Scale new heights by identifying the most effective talents for your firm. Most websites have round hyperlinks, which implies that you may return to the unique page when you comply with a link after link. Each domain/website has it’s own distinctive construction and web page-to-page relations and hyperlinks.
While many suppose that when you publish a post on a web site it’s going to mechanically be displayed to everyone trying to find it through Google or Bing, this is not the case. In order for a web web page to be listed, it must first be crawled. Getting crawled is a necessity because it — and a variety of search engine-specific algorithms — determines whether or not or not your web site will get listed. But after studying this weblog, we hope you may be clear concerning the that means, the points of distinction, and the usage of each. Thereby, you would nonetheless be sued since you infringed a copyrighted database.
In this fashion, web scraping has a lot of functions in retail marketing. In retail, there are quite a few avenues whereby web scraping is getting used. Whether it’s competitor worth monitoring or MAP compliance monitoring, internet scraping is being utilized to extract valuable data and glean the important insights from it. It’s designed to make internet scraping a very easy exercise. In return, the scraper gets the requested data in HTML format.
The website’s APIs often monitor and limit the data you’re attempting to harvest. This won’t set off any factors if you’re using the API for one time only. Links to numerous totally different websites accompany the crawling cycle. Not only do they flick through pages, nevertheless in addition they collect all the relevant info that indexes them throughout the course of. ×Be as particular as potential with steps to take to be able to course of the knowledge you want.
It means you should understand how the web site/information source you goal is structured and plan your internet scraping operation. When you design a system for aggregating publicly obtainable information from the web, it’s crucial to grasp the steps and determination factors you are dealing with.
Crawling VS Scraping
Using this extension, you’ll be capable of create a plan how a website on-line should be traversed and what ought to be extracted. which we name extraction and that after more requires few algorithms and some automation in place.
So as you can see, internet crawlers are important in generating correct results. Web crawlers sort the pages and likewise assess the quality of content and carry out many different features to carry Online Email Extractor out the indexing as an finish end result. Web crawlers crawl the billions of internet pages to be able to generate outcomes that users are looking for. As per altering consumer demand, web crawlers should adapt to it as properly.
When you select to get data with the assistance of a web site’s API, you could be very restricted throughout the customization. You can’t management elements of customization comparable to format, development, fields, frequency or any other specific traits. It’s merely unimaginable to get a extreme diploma of data customization with API. Also, when there are particular modifications within the website, these modifications throughout the information construction would replicate in the API solely months later. Scraping, nonetheless, is focusing on key identifiers and honing in on them.
” as one must answer whether the scraping carried out doesn’t breach any legal guidelines surrounding the stated data. However, internet scraping can be accomplished manually without the help of a crawler . In distinction, an internet crawler is normally accompanied by scraping, to filter out the pointless info.
You would want dependable and newest knowledge concerning your space of work. No matter what your field of operation is, you want access to tons of information. Web scraping is usually not carried out for innocent, academic purposes. When you’re partaking in internet scraping, you may not discover it offensive or unethical.
Data scraping tools have a slender operate that may be adjusted or customized to any scope. Data scraping can pull current inventory costs, resort charges, real estate listings and so forth. Data crawling is rather more subtle and goes into the intricacies of digging deep, no matter their mission may be, these bots are on a quest. They will verify all the backlinks and not stop till everything that is even remotely related has been scrutinized. Data crawling is finished on a grand scale that requires special care as to not offend the sources or break any legal guidelines.
With the ever-growing quantity of data data and paperwork, your crawling system accommodates storage and extensibility in abundance. Each web page has over a hundred hyperlinks and about kb of textual information, and the home it takes to fetch the knowledge from each net page is close to 350kb. Multiplying that with over four hundred billion pages entails one hundred forty petabytes of data per crawl. Thereby, the data extracted by the use of an API gadget might be not reliable.
  • Keep these few ideas about internet scraping vs web crawling behind your mind before diving into your subsequent research project.
  • Moving even deeper into the topic, scraping vs crawling is the difference between collection and computation.
  • Collection is beneficial when all one requires is information, but computation digs additional into the amount of information obtainable.
  • And don’t overlook, net scraping could be an isolated event, while net crawling combines the two.
  • To reiterate a few factors, web scraping extracts established, ‘structured information.’ You must have known we’d circle back to that all-necessary point.

As you’ll be able to see in Craiglist issue, it was not so much concerning the information itself. But it is far more concerning the abusive entry and use of the data. We have put together key points for you to find out how authorized or unlawful your internet scraping exercise is. Craigslist sued a company Web Scraping, Data Extraction and Automation known as Instamotor for scraping its content material to create their own listings and sending mails to Craigslist users for selling used automobiles. There are various ways by which internet scraping is a good help with out which the digital world as we know it might come to a standstill.
This is further sometimes completed by firms seeking to conduct deep info analyses for a extremely specific use. Data crawling firms Torrent Proxies withdraw duplicate data from the textual content which will have been copied/pasted, as they will’t inform the excellence.
Data scraping is defined as amassing knowledge and then scraping it. It is mandatory to procure user consent prior to running these cookies in your website. Earlier methods in scraping concerned complicated regular expressions and relying heavily on how the tags have been laid out on the positioning. Although using regular expressions is not completely removed, availability of queries on the XPath and DOM levels have made this much simpler.

Difference Between Creeping And Crawling


Most do, yes, nevertheless, this doesn’t indicate that you can easily use their API to extract data. Firstly, APIs do not present entry to all the information obtainable. Secondly, even should you may entry the data, you would have to adhere to all the speed limits which are referred to in the next section.

Web Crawling Vs Web Scraping: The Differences


×Be as specific as possible with steps to take so as to process the data you want. Please record particular actions taken to be able to reach the information wanted. Author Bio




About the Author: Constanzo is a blogger at shop.manitobaharvest, hemp-tek and mallscenters.

Contacts:

Facebook

Twitter

Instagram

LinkedIn

Email

Telephone:+1 631-396-0783,631.396.0783,11741 631.396.0783

Address: 1088 Bishop StreetHonolulu, Hawaii

Published Articles:

Portfolio

As Featured in

https://www.simplybe.co.uk/
https://www.marksandspencer.com
http://ft.com/
https://people.com/
http://mirror.co.uk/It might take as much as 2 enterprise days to course of your request depending on the complexity of the project. We will review your request and provide you with a pricing quote as quickly as potential.

When it comes to Parsing, it normally applies to any computer language. It is the method of taking the code as text and producing a construction in reminiscence that the pc can understand and work with.

To put the talk to rest, we now have put collectively this blog that dispels all the myths relating to legality of net scraping. A lot of people are undecided whether or not net scraping is authorized or not. You would possibly think that you can get a competitive edge if you will get hold of this knowledge. Some of the popular net scraping instruments are ProWebScraper, Webscraper.io, and so on.

Web Scraping Sports Data: Innovative Way To Beat Your Competition


Without web crawling, you wouldn’t have Google supplying you with search results in an more and more more correct and effective method. Google crawls around 25 billion or more pages daily to provide the search results. Basically, machine learning is about enabling the machine to find patterns and insights for you. However, for that to occur, you should feed the machine plenty of data. Hence, net scraping is integral to machine learning because it could simply and shortly facilitate all kinds of web information in a dependable manner.
It also clarifies what the website considers “good behavior” in terms of entry, restricted web pages and frequency of crawling. In any method, your net scraping should not have an effect on the website and the server.
Being informed on what’s taking place in the market, your corporation can reply to any changes accordingly and decrease losses and maximize sales. However, after going through Facebook Email Scraper the variations that exist between them, you’ll discover they don’t seem to be the equivalent.
Crawling VS Scraping

Having grown up on video video video games and the internet, she grew to hunt out the tech facet of things increasingly extra attention-grabbing over the years. So when you ever find yourself desirous to be taught additional about proxies , be at liberty to contact her – she’ll be more than pleased to answer you.
Crawling VS Scraping
While not exclusive to search engines, other sites typically use net crawling or spidering software to replace their own internet content or index the content material of different web sites. Since these bots visit sites without permission, web site house owners preferring not to be indexed will customize the robots.txt file with requests to not be crawled. Examples of crawlers may be those utilized by Google (“Googlebot”), Bing (“Bingbot”) or Yahoo (“Slurp Bot”).

Is Data Scraping A Headache For Small Business Owners?


Hence, net scraping comes in fairly useful in extracting the big variety of pictures and product descriptions for an e-commerce business. For online market, you badly need internet scraping to match the tempo with the lightning-quick modifications occurring every moment.
Web scraping is basically extracting data from web sites in an automated method. While the online is filled with references to internet scraping and crawling, it might not help until you learn its definition in a simpler language. It’s due to internet scraping and web crawling, if not completely equivalent, are related and even the same to some extent. Spider and crawler can be utilized interchangeably when referring to a software used for web crawling.

If you wish to audit your individual web site, check for damaged hyperlinks and customarily do some web optimization guru magic, you may need to look into Screaming Frog, a SEO crawler. With the software crawling your web site, it could possibly detect 404 errors, analyse your Meta Data, discover duplicates – all in all, collect all information potential. If you wish to download the information gathered, you’d want to go for net scraping instead. I trust up to now that this article has proven you ways the map is created and methods to access the treasure trove of data on the internet. Big knowledge is altering the landscape of doing business and this evolution appears to simply be getting started.

A web site would make adjustments to their website however the same modifications within the data structure would reflect in the API months later. Yes, they do however as a rule there are many limitations on the data that’s available by way of the API. Even if the API offered access to all the info, you would have to adhere to their price limits.

What Is Data Crawling?


Social Media Data Take one of the best selections based mostly on what’s trending amongst fans and followers. Retail & Ecommerce Data Monitor merchandise and retailers to remain ahead of the competitors.
Crawling VS Scraping